Biography of Demi Moore
Demi Moore, born Demetria Gene Guynes on November 11, 1962, in Roswell, New Mexico, emerged from a challenging childhood to become one of Hollywood's most recognizable faces. Her journey from a modest upbringing to stardom is a testament to her resilience and determination. Moore's early life was marked by instability, with her parents divorcing before she was born and her stepfather frequently changing jobs, leading the family to move often.
Despite these challenges, Moore found solace in acting and modeling, eventually dropping out of high school to pursue her dreams. Her breakthrough came with her role on the television soap opera "General Hospital" in the early 1980s, which set the stage for her transition to film. Over the years, Moore has become known for her intense performances, often taking on roles that challenge societal norms and push boundaries.

What was Demi Moore's early life like?
Demi Moore's early life was far from glamorous. Born in Roswell, New Mexico, Moore's childhood was characterized by frequent moves due to her stepfather's job as a newspaper advertising salesman. Her family faced financial difficulties, and her parents' tumultuous relationship added to the instability. Moore's biological father left before she was born, and her mother and stepfather struggled with alcohol abuse, creating a challenging environment for her and her siblings.
Despite these challenges, Moore found a passion for acting and modeling during her teenage years. Encouraged by her beauty and charisma, she pursued opportunities in Los Angeles, eventually landing a contract with Elite Model Management. This step marked the beginning of her journey into the entertainment industry. Moore's determination to escape her troubled past and create a better future for herself drove her to seize every opportunity that came her way.
Career Breakthrough in the '80s
The 1980s were a pivotal decade for Demi Moore, marking her transition from television to the big screen. Her role in the popular soap opera "General Hospital" provided her with the exposure needed to launch her film career. Moore's breakout role came in 1985 with the film "St. Elmo's Fire," part of the "Brat Pack" group of young actors, which also included Rob Lowe and Emilio Estevez.
Following "St. Elmo's Fire," Moore starred in a string of successful films, cementing her status as a leading lady in Hollywood. Her performance in "About Last Night..." showcased her ability to handle complex characters, while "Ghost" (1990) catapulted her to international fame. The latter film, a supernatural romantic thriller, was a box office sensation, and Moore's performance earned her critical acclaim.
The Iconic Roles of Demi Moore
Demi Moore's filmography is filled with iconic roles that have defined her career. Her portrayal of Molly Jensen in "Ghost" remains one of her most memorable performances, endearing her to audiences around the world. The chemistry between Moore and co-star Patrick Swayze was electric, and the film's emotional depth resonated with viewers, making it a classic.
Another standout role came in 1992 with "A Few Good Men," where Moore starred alongside Tom Cruise and Jack Nicholson. Her performance as Lieutenant Commander JoAnne Galloway, a determined military lawyer, showcased her ability to hold her own against some of Hollywood's biggest stars. The film's success further solidified Moore's reputation as a talented actress capable of delivering powerful performances.
Who has Demi Moore dated?
Demi Moore's personal life, particularly her relationships, has been a subject of public fascination. She has been married three times, with each relationship garnering significant media attention. Moore's first marriage was to musician Freddy Moore in 1980, but the union ended in divorce five years later. She retained his surname as her professional name.
In 1987, Moore married actor Bruce Willis, and the couple became one of Hollywood's most high-profile duos. During their marriage, they welcomed three daughters: Rumer, Scout, and Tallulah. Despite their divorce in 2000, Moore and Willis have maintained a close friendship, co-parenting their children and supporting each other in their personal and professional endeavors.

Demi Moore's Philanthropic Endeavors
Beyond her acting career, Demi Moore is also known for her philanthropic efforts. She has been actively involved in various charitable organizations, focusing on issues such as human trafficking, women's rights, and child welfare. Moore co-founded the "Demi and Ashton Foundation" (later renamed "THORN: Digital Defenders of Children") with her then-husband Ashton Kutcher, aiming to combat human trafficking and the sexual exploitation of children.
Through THORN, Moore has worked to raise awareness and support initiatives that leverage technology to fight trafficking and provide resources for victims. Her commitment to philanthropy reflects her desire to use her platform for positive change, advocating for those who are often marginalized and voiceless. Moore's dedication to these causes demonstrates her compassion and willingness to take action in addressing some of society's most pressing issues.
Books and Publications by Demi Moore
In addition to her work in film and philanthropy, Demi Moore is also an accomplished author. Her memoir, "Inside Out," published in 2019, offers a candid and introspective look at her life, career, and personal struggles. The book delves into her complex relationships, battles with addiction, and the journey to self-discovery and healing.
"Inside Out" received critical acclaim for its honesty and vulnerability, providing readers with an intimate glimpse into Moore's life beyond the headlines. The memoir not only resonated with fans but also sparked important conversations about mental health, addiction, and the pressures faced by women in Hollywood. Through her writing, Moore continues to inspire others by sharing her story and the lessons she has learned along the way.
What is Demi Moore's influence and legacy?
Demi Moore's influence and legacy extend far beyond her filmography. As one of the first actresses to command a $10 million salary, Moore paved the way for future generations of women in Hollywood to demand equal pay and recognition. Her willingness to take risks with unconventional roles challenged traditional gender norms and expanded the scope of female representation on screen.
Moore's impact is also evident in her advocacy for women's rights and her efforts to combat human trafficking. Her philanthropic work has inspired others in the entertainment industry to use their platforms for social good, highlighting the importance of giving back and making a difference in the world.
